About 2021 Exeed TXL

The Exeed TXL (facelift 2021) is a midsize SUV that offers a compelling blend of style, practicality, and modern design enhancements. Introduced in 2021 and continuing production to the present, this SUV generation serves the growing demand for vehicles that balance spaciousness with urban maneuverability. The TXL facelift features a length of 4780 mm (188.2 inches), a width of 1890 mm (74.4 inches), and a height of 1730 mm (68.1 inches), positioning it comfortably in the midsize SUV segment. The Exeed TXL’s curb weight ranges between 1650 kg (3638 lbs) and 1765 kg (3890 lbs) depending on the configuration and trim level, which ensures stable road handling and a solid presence on the road. Buyers can select from a variety of rim sizes including 18, 19, and 20 inches, paired with corresponding tire sizes of 225/60 R18, 235/50 R19, and 245/45 R20 respectively. These options provide a balance between ride comfort and sporty aesthetics. Engine and Performance

The 2021 Exeed TXL facelift is equipped with a 1.6-liter turbocharged inline-4 engine, delivering around 197 horsepower and 290 Nm of torque, paired with a 7-speed dual-clutch transmission for smooth acceleration and efficient power delivery.

Exterior Design

The facelift features a refreshed front fascia with a new, larger grille design, slimmer LED headlights, and redesigned bumpers, giving the TXL a more upscale and modern look compared to the previous model.

Interior and Comfort

Inside, the 2021 TXL boasts a spacious cabin with premium materials, a fully digital instrument cluster, and a large touchscreen infotainment system. It also offers features like ambient lighting and ventilated front seats for enhanced comfort.

Safety Features

The TXL is equipped with advanced safety technologies including adaptive cruise control, lane-keeping assist, autonomous emergency braking, blind-spot monitoring, and a 360-degree camera system to ensure driver and passenger safety.

Technology and Connectivity

This model includes key modern tech such as wireless phone charging, Apple CarPlay and Android Auto compatibility, multiple USB ports, and a high-quality sound system, aimed at providing a connected and enjoyable driving experience.

The 2021 Exeed TXL facelift offers a range of rim sizes including 18-, 19-, and 20-inch wheels. Corresponding tire sizes are 225/60 R18, 235/50 R19, and 245/45 R20 respectively. These options provide flexibility for buyers who prioritize different ride comfort, handling traits, or aesthetic preferences. Larger wheels generally enhance the SUV's visual appeal and road grip but might reduce ride softness slightly, while smaller wheels favor comfort and efficiency.

The 2021 Exeed TXL facelift offers multiple rim and tire sizes: 18-inch rims with 225/60 R18 tires, 19-inch rims with 235/50 R19 tires, and 20-inch rims with 245/45 R20 tires. For drivers prioritizing ride comfort and a softer suspension feel, the 18-inch wheel setup with taller tire sidewalls is preferable, as it better absorbs road imperfections. For those seeking sharper handling and sportier aesthetics, the 19- or 20-inch options provide improved grip and responsiveness at the cost of a slightly firmer ride. Ultimately, the choice depends on personal preference and driving conditions, with all options maintaining safety and vehicle performance standards.
